## What is BlueWatch for Bangle.js?

An open-source app to connect your Bangle.js 2 for native integration into the iOS ecosystem, including Apple Health and Shortcuts. Build from the ground up to support the Bangle.js platform, and has support for web bluetooth app loaders, with integrated web bluetooth connection. Use shortcuts actions to create your own complex workflows and automations, tapping into the spirit of the open-source, infinitely customizable Bangle.js. 
BlueWatch is open-source, and anyone can contribute, suggest new features, or add support for more devices at https://github.com/RKBoss6/BlueWatch
Features:
- Pushes weather data
- Pushes location data
- Seamlessly access and connect your watch to the Bangle.js app loader
- Can act as a GPS for your watch
- If enabled, pushes health data to Apple Health
- Adds actions in shortcuts for creation of your own custom workflows using location, weather, and other automation triggers.

## Version history (last 5 releases)

### 1.4.2 — 2026-08-25

This update does not require an update to the Bangle.js app, and contains many new changes and improvements.
Changes:
- NEW: Spanish, French, and German localizations
- Changed metrics views on the main screen to show glanceable cards for quick information rather than full-page graphs.
- Added an info sheet about languages and localizations to the 'more' tab
- Fixes reported crash some users face when Bangle disconnects.
- Fixes app loader bug where uploads would fail due to control flow errors.
- Find my phone now uses full volume and restores previous volume upon finish
- Expanded metric view UI changes
- Customize which metrics to show/hide on the main screen
- Web View now supports pull-to refresh with a setting to enable/disable it
- Changing web view settings no longer require a restart to take effect
- Fixed bug with web view not able to send any data resulting in hangs
- Removed unused buttons to clean up UI
- General stability improvements

### 1.4 — 2026-08-18

Requires an update to the Bangle.js app to version v0.04, found at 'espruino.github.io/BangleApps'
Changes: 
- Changed version naming convention to match the Bangle app (1.4 & v0.04)
- NEW: Added shortcuts actions: Send Message, Push Weather, Check Connection, and Push Location
- NEW: Added support for active and resting calories and saving to Health, provided the Bangle.js 'Calories' app is installed
- Code optimizations
- Changed dark mode app icon slightly
- UI Improvements

### 1.2.1 — 2026-08-11

This update does not require an update to the Bangle.js app.
Changes:
- Numerous stability fixes
- App now supports iPad
- Fixed bug with bluetooth not connecting in background for some users
- Fixed bug with handshake not completing most of the time for some users
- Added 'more' section with contributing / repository info, and the Bangle.js companion app version needed, as well as an entry to settings
- Fixed bug with app not waking up after a long disconnect
- Added new permissions menu to manage app permissions and see what is needed and why
- Code optimizations
- Added new setting to show/hide the find phone alarm confirmation notification after it is triggered
- Slight UI improvements

### 1.2 — 2026-08-03

Requires update to Bangle.js app to v0.03, found at 'espruino.github.io/BangleApps'
Changes:
- Fix bug where bluetooth handshake would fail frequently
- You can now see full day-by-day data in the past (heart rate, steps, battery)
- Settings UI tweaks
- New setting for bluetooth chunk optimization (more reliable bluetooth sending)
- Changes in dark mode colors for better contrast
- Added force-disconnect and handshake retry buttons
- Show manufacturer in device selection screen
- Tweak labels on graphs for concision

### 1.1 — 2026-07-23

Make sure you update the Bangle.js companion to this app to 'v0.02' in order for this update to work smoothly on your device. You can find it at "www.espruino.github.io/BangleApps"
Changes:
- New location rate limit setting for battery life optimization
- New redundant handshake method for less rejected connections
- Fixed bug with HealthKit steps ballooning exponentially
- Vibration in find phone alert
- Permissions section in settings to reshow permission request if not marked yes or no already
